Types of Credit Cards – Airline
Could be worth paying fee for: - Free night certificates - Elite Status - Discounted award redemptions
Types of Credit Cards –Hotel
Types of Credit Cards – Cash Back
- 1 to 2% on purchases - ~5% on categories - Easy to understand - Good for coach travel - $5,000 business class ticket = $250,000 spending
- $80,000 spending on AMEX SPG = 100,000 AA Miles
- How it works
- Sign-up for card and get sign-on bonus (25K to 100K)
- Usually have to spend a minimum amount $3,000 in 3 months
- Then what?
Earning Miles & Points – Credit Cards
- Spend everything you earn, you’ll get only 50,000 miles/points
- Pay-off is with the SIGN-UP BONUS,
NOT everyday spending
Earning Miles & Points – Credit Cards
Spending on Cards with no/low NET cash outflow - William Paid for Rent - Charge Smart for loans Pre-Paid Cards - Wells Fargo (Don’t use Citi & BOA) - US Bank Visa Buxx - ALWAYS check for cash advance fees

- Business Cards
- Don’t need an established business - Selling stuff on ebay etc. - Use SSN as Tax ID number
- Reconsideration - Call and ask to move credit lines to get approved for new card
- Churning Strategy - Each bank will pull credit report from a credit bureau - Goal is to apply for cards with mix of 3 bureaus - In NJ most pulls from Experian
- Retention - Citi great at offering incentive to keep card

- Two types of miles
- Elite & Redeemable
- Usually 1 mile per flown mile
- Earth’s circumference is 25,000 miles
- More miles in First or Business Class (50% to 100%)
- Elite miles earn status which gets you perks
- Very valuable for frequent traveler
Earning Miles & Points - Flying

App-O-Rama Planning
- Not approved online
- Max out available credit or too many inquiries
- Call Reconsideration Department after applying
- Relationship, Credit Worthiness, Business Info
- Good reason for wanting card
- Show that you’re not a credit risk
- Hang Up and Call Again!
Reconsideration
